What Is CBD?

CBD and THC both come from cannabis plants but come from different cannabis plants. While full-spectrum CBD products are derived from hemp, full-spectrum THC products come from marijuana. Yes, believe it or not, “hemp” and “marijuana” aren’t completely interchangeable.

Hemp does have traces of THC, but it must contain less than 0.3% to be legal in the US. 0.3% of THC is essentially negligible, though a plant’s THC levels also depend on many factors such as strain. While 0.3% will show up on a substance test, it will not get your pet high.

All this explains why CBD is only used for therapeutic purposes while THC is used for both therapeutic and recreational purposes. So if you’re worried about your pet experiencing any psychoactive “high” from THC, know that it won’t happen with reputable CBD products.

CBD for Pets — Dosage

CBD dosage is a finicky subject, especially when it comes to pets. While humans can roughly estimate their dosage by factors such as age, weight, height, etc, pets can’t.

This applies especially to dogs. While CBD products will have a general dosing label based on weight, the breed also plays a huge factor in dosage. That means a small dog might be able to naturally tolerate a dosage higher than a big dog can because of its breed.

To stay on the safe side, use this guide to determine the dosage. It will instruct you to dose based on weight, but use it as a general guideline. Then, dose your pet half of the suggested dosage. Work your way up until you find the sweet spot, understanding when your pet feels relief and when they feel discomfort.
